A basic rule of thumb for furnace size calculation is that it takes 30 BTUs for every square foot of house. So, if you have a 1,000 square foot house, you need a furnace that has a 30,000 BTU output.

WebApr 11, 2024 · To calculate what size air conditioner you need, calculate the square footage of your home and multiply it by 20 to get the BTUs needed. Every 12,000 BTUs is equal to one ton. What size room will a 12,000 BTU air conditioner cool? A 12,000 BTU unit will cool a 400 to 600-square-foot space.
